Lincoln Trail Area Development District Receives Federal Grant
$565,867 awarded for BRAC-related community adjustment

WASHINGTON, D.C –February 7, 2007 – U.S. Rep. Ron Lewis (KY-02) announced today that the Lincoln Trail Area Development District (LTADD) has been awarded $565,897. The grant, awarded by the U.S. Department of Defense Office of Economic Adjustment at, will be used to support community adjustment projects in response to base realignment at Fort Knox

As a result of the 2005 Base Realignment and Closure Commission recommendations, Fort Knox is transforming into a multi-functional installation that will include an active duty infantry brigade combat team and staff support commands. Many of the communities that surround Fort Knox are preparing for the arrival of thousands of new military and civilian employees and their families.

The One Knox Policy Council, an organization of local civic and government leaders within the Lincoln Trail Area Development District, was created to coordinate infrastructure needs necessary to accommodate anticipated population growth. Considerations include the construction of new homes, schools, businesses, and road improvements.

 

 Grant funds will be applied to support ongoing public information, community outreach and policy support functions.
